Space missions demand more from every hardware component: long-term reliability, reduced size and weight, and seamless integration in some of the harshest environments imaginable. From radiation exposure and mechanical stress to extreme temperature swings, interconnect systems must deliver consistent functionality over long durations. At the same time growing demand for data-intensive applications like Earth observation and global communications are pushing engineers to rethink how space systems are built and connected.

Solutions to these evolving technical challenges must be engineered for durability, density and data integrity. High-reliability designs are essential to prevent mission failure and protect valuable equipment. Space connectors must also deliver more functionality in a reduced footprint, supporting compact system designs while enabling high-speed communication, real-time processing and efficient data handling throughout the mission lifecycle.

Miniaturized Interconnects Maximize Payload and Minimize Launch Costs

The growing complexity of space missions puts increased pressure on engineering to reduce system size and weight. Compact, high-density interconnects are essential to free up space for added instrumentation or fuel, extending mission range and capability. Lightweight space connectors from Molex and AirBorn are engineered for optimal space efficiency, enabling more functionality in a smaller footprint while minimizing launch costs and maximizing design flexibility.

Maintaining Signal Integrity in Data-Intensive Space Applications

The rising demand for data-driven applications, ranging from Earth observation to onboard processing, requires space systems capable of handling large volumes of information at high speeds. To keep pace, space connectors must deliver reliable, high-bandwidth performance with minimal signal loss. Molex and AirBorn provide high-density interconnects and integrated power-data systems that preserve signal integrity, supporting fast, secure data flow in compact, mission-critical designs.
